    Remove the auxiliary keys made of metal from the case of the Mazda keyfob. You'll notice two slots on either side of the case. Be careful not to break or snap the case when prying it open with a tape-wrapped screwdriver. Then, remove the battery that was in use and replace it with a brand new one, ensuring that the positive (+) side of the battery is facing upwards.

    After you've removed your cap on the battery, you can replace it with a replacement that is compatible. Select a battery that is that is the same type and size as the original one to ensure that your key fob works correctly. Place the new battery inside the key fob with the positive (+ side) facing upwards. Replace the battery cover, and then the fob case by pressing down until you hear a click.
